    Fratilor si surorilor, salamu alaikom wa rahmatul Allahi wa barakatoh


    Acest subiect este tradus de la o lectia in limba araba facuta de Sheikul "Ibrahim Al-duwayesh" inshaAllah sa fie de folos pt noi toti,
    si sa ma scuzati daca am gresit cu traducerea




    CE FRUMOASA ESTE GENNA sau RARADISUL

    Am vazut ca sufletul meu s-a inclinat pt viata si s-a innecat in frumusetea ei,am vrut sa-l salvez......am incercat sa-l tratez,m-am dus sa fac multe rugaciuni dar nu era de ajuns,am inceput sa intreb pe cei din jurul meu ce sa fac,apoi m-am pus in mana lui Allah,ma plangeam la el prin ce am trecut si cum m-am schimbat...... si El nu ma dezamagit, si am cautat despre paradisul si descrierea lui.am stiut ca inimii din cind in cind le trebuie o hrana ca aceasta, pt ca hrana asta este ca si combustibilul pt o calatorie lunga in care drumul ei este plin de dorinte care stralucesc tot timpul.in special dorintele din timpul nostru.si nu mi-am gasit pt sufletul meu un tratament mai bun de cit sa-mi amintesc de genna si
    bunastarea ei.

    IBN AL-JAWZI a zis...."wallahi traiul adevarat este numai in genna....si wallahi imi imaginez cum este intrarea in genna si traiul permanent in ea fara imbolnavire sau o boala, ci o sanatate permanenta intr-o bunastare continua tot timpul...etc"

    Aceasta este genna...bunastare permanenta....vorba despre ea este consolarea tristetii,descrierea ei este calmarea sufletelor, si vorba despre ea nu plitiseste pe cei care asculta.

    deci...am uitat fratilor si surorilor de genna??

    Subaha Allah....uitati-va la situatia oamenilorde acum,uitati-va la viata din jurul vostru...dorinte,tehnologii,televiziuni...bani si afaceri...calatorii, turism si distractia...plaje si cabane...verdeata si peisaje frumoase.

    asa este cu multi oameni din timpul nostru are au inima intarita,speranta
    lunga,slabiciune in credinta,au uitat de "Gradinile pline de tihna si placere"??
    oameni cei bogati si cei saraci fug dupa viata si bunastarea ei, concureaza intre ei cu bani si luxurile vietii.....
    cei bogati cauta luxul mai mult,iar cei saraci incearca sa-i imita pe cei bogati dar li se ingreuneaza lor acest lucru.deci toti in afara de cei pe care i-a ferit Allah s-au inecat in inundatia luxului si a dorintelor.am uitat de adevarul vietii,cerem o viata frumoasa dar si incercam sa zicem ca e buna si frumoasa,si multi care nu au viata buna sunt trisiti, dar sunt unii care s-au suparat ca nu a avut o viata frumoasa. si cine a avut o viata frmoasa a uitat ca e o bunastare temporara,...ca si visele, cu tristete si griji, boli si datorii...oboseala, nervozitate si nefericire.
    deci daca asa este situatia...omul destept printre noi trebuie sa se intrebe..... "intradevar asta e bunastarea adevarata"??? am uitat de bunastarea care nu se termina??? si care nu se intrerupe??

    nimieni nu poate sa descrie genna indiferent cit de multe cuvinte stie,tremura inima omului credincios cind asculta despre ea si descrierea ei.

    deci o cei saracii ...sa nu uitati ca este o bunastare permanenta si sa nu fiti tristi pt ca cei saraci intra in rai inainte de cei bogati cu 40 de ani,asa cum a zis profetul Muhammad saaws.

    o cei bogati...chiar daca ati ajuns la un nivel mare,chiar daca ati trait in castele, chiar daca erau castelele voastre inconjurate de gradini, pomi si flori,si daca erau mobilate cu cele mai frumoase mobile, sa va amintiti de ["caminele bune in gradinile Edenului"].["in gradini pe sub care curg paraie"]

    deci fratilor si suroirilor sa nu uitati de genna...bunastarea care nu a vazut-o nimeni si despre care nu a auzit nici un om.nici nu-i trece prin cap la nimeni cum este.

    As-Salaam `Alaykum, I would like to ask a few questions regarding the Hereafter. I've searched a few places to find the answer(s) but unfortunately I couldn't find the answer I was looking for.

    I have seen questions being posted that are similar to mine, but I felt the answers (or perhaps the questions themselves) were too general. In sha’ Allah, if you could help me and give me a more specific answer I would appreciate it a great deal.

    My first question is: how will the believing women of this world be rewarded in Jannah (Paradise)? Surah 56:17 reads: "They will be served by immortal boys”, " If I am not mistaken, is this talking about the youthful boys serving women? Or is that for both men and women – and what is their role? Will the believing men be married to the Houri's? And what will be the status of their own wives?
    Another question: is the matter of "72 virgins" true or false? If it's true could you please provide evidence.

    And my last question is: if one enters Hell / Paradise they will "abide therein forever". How does this work if some believers are put in Hell for some time and then taken out into Paradise? Does this mean some will enter Paradise for a time and taken out and put into Hell?

    Wa`alykum As-Salaamu wa Rahmatullahi wa Barakaatuh.
    In the Name of Allah, Most Gracious, Most Merciful.
    All praise and thanks are due to Allah, and peace and blessings be upon His Messenger.
    Dear sister in Islam, we would like to thank you for showing keenness on knowing the teachings of Islam, and we appreciate the great confidence you have in us. We hope our efforts meet your expectations.
    In an attempt to furnish you with the answer to oyur question, we would like to cite for you the following fatwa issued by Sheikh Hamed Al-Ali, instructor of Islamic Heritage at the Faculty of Education, Kuwait and Imam of Dahiat As-Sabahiyya Mosque, in which he states the following:
    Almighty Allah will reward righteous women the same way He rewards righteous men. Women are entitled to all kinds of reward in Jannah (Paradise).

    As for the young people who are to cater for the inhabitants of Jannah, there is no evidence that this applies to women, but it is possible and there is no proof to deny it, especially that they are young and this is even allowed in this world, so it is the same with the Hereafter.

    The righteous woman, if they enter Jannah, will accompany her husband, and she will be more beautiful than the Hour -ul-`Ein (the Fair women of Paradise). Her reward in Jannah will be more than the Hour -ul-`Ein. The Hadith concerning 70 Houris is authentic and it is reported as regards the one who dies as a martyr in the Cause of Allah. The reward in Jannah will be according to each one’s good deeds.

    As for people who committed major sins, but not apostasy, and died as Muslims, except that they did not make Tawbah (repentance) for their evil deeds in this life, they will be punished according to their sins, then after they are purified from their sins (by means of punishment) they will enter Jannah for ever.

    People who enter Jannah will abide therein forever. But it’s to be stressed that condemning some sinful people to be temporarily chastised in the Hell-Fire and then be admitted to Jannah is to purify them from their sins, as people who enter Jannah should be pure and free of sins. Thus those who didn’t purify themselves by making Tawbah will be purified by the punishment in the grave; if it is not enough to purify them they will enter the Hell-Fire to get purified of their sins, then they will enter Jannah pure and free of all sins.

    Jannah is the place of reward and pleasure, that is why no one will enter it while still having sins on his record. On the contrary, anyone qualified to enter Jannah in the first place will not enter the Hell-fire; it does not make sense that Almighty Allah will take the people out of Jannah after showering them with His Mercy and blessings and then put them in the Hell-Fire; Exalted be Allah from this injustice!

    Respected scholars, As-Salamu `alaykum. Whenever I read the Holy Qur’an, it always makes me wonder what would be the life of a female in Paradise or Jannah. The Qur’an talks about life after death and gives information that how a MAN's life is going to be in the other life. They will live in gardens where there are rivers and trees full of fruits. But I never read a passage that describes the lives of women in Jannah. If so, please let me know where in the Qur’an I can find information in this regard. How will women be rewarded in Paradise?

    Wa `alaykum As-Salamu wa Rahmatullahi wa Barakatuh.

    In the Name of Allah, Most Gracious, Most Merciful.

    All praise and thanks are due to Allah, and peace and blessings be upon His Messenger.

    Sister, first of all, we’d like to say that we are impressed by your question, which emanates from a thoughtful heart. May Allah Almighty help us all adhere to the principles of this true religion, Islam, and enable us to be among the dwellers of Paradise in the Hereafter, Ameen!

    As regards your question, it should be clear that Paradise is the abode of happiness; all its dwellers, males or females, will be showered with Allah’s blessings and favors. There is no discrimination in this regard between men and women. It is righteousness and good deeds that elevates one’s rank in Jannah and exalts his/her position. In more than one Qur'anic verse, Allah, Most High, calls upon His servants to do their utmost in order to be favored with Paradise. For example, He says, And vie one with another for forgiveness from your Lord, and for a Paradise as wide as are the heavens and the earth, prepared for those who ward off (evil).  (Aal `Imran 3: 133)

    In this context, Dr. Muzammil H. Siddiqi, former President of the Islamic Society of North America, states:
    Jannah or Paradise is not for men alone. It is prepared for both, righteous men and righteous women. All the joys and blessings of Jannah are for both of them. Allah has mentioned in the Qur’an that He put both Adam and his wife Hawwa’ (Eve) in Jannah after creating them, and He told them to eat and enjoy everything (except the fruit of one tree). [See al-Baqarah 2: 35; al-A`raf 7: 19] Thus, all the trees, gardens and rivers of Jannah are made for both men and women and they both will enjoy them.

    All Believers, males and females, will enter the Jannah. Allah says,  Gardens of perpetual bliss: they shall enter there, as well as the righteous among their fathers, their spouses, and their offspring (ar-Ra`d 13: 23)

    Further, Allah says, Indeed, the people of Paradise will be happily occupied. They and their wives shall be in shades, reclining on raised couches. There are for them fruits and there is for them all that they ask for… (Ya-Sin 36: 55-57)

    In the Hereafter Allah will say to the Believers, Enter the Garden, you and your wives, you will be made glad. There will be brought round for them trays of gold and goblets, and therein is all that the souls desire and eyes find sweet and you will stay there forever. This is the garden, which you are made to inherit because of what you used to do. Therein for you is fruit in plenty whence to eat.  (Az-Zukhruf 43: 70-73)

    There are many other places in the Qur’an where it is mentioned that men and women both will find their reward and none will be deprived. [See: Aal `Imran 3: 195; An-Nisa’, 4: 124; An-Nahl 16: 97; Al-Ahzab 33: 35; Ghafir 40: 40]

    The life of women in Jannah will be as pleasant and happy as the life of men. Allah is not partial to any gender. He created both of them and He will take care of both of them according to their needs and desires. Let us all work to achieve the Jannah and then, in sha’ Allah, we will find there what will satisfy all of us fully.

    This verse clearly denotes that those women who do righteous deeds are rewarded with Paradise and given a high rank that is equal to the good deeds they have offered.
    Shedding more light on this issue, we'd like to cite the following fatwa issued by the outstanding Muslim scholar, Sheikh ibn Jibreen:
    There is no doubt that reward in the Hereafter encompasses both men and women. This is based on the following Qur'anic verses:

     Lo! I suffer not the work of any worker, male or female, to be lost (Al `Imran 3: 195)

    Whosoever works righteousness, whether male or female, while he (or she) is a true believer, We will give a good life.  (An-Nahl 16: 97)

    And whoever does righteous good deeds, being a male or a female, and is a true believer, such will enter Paradise.  (An-Nisa 4: 124)

    Verily, the Muslims, men and women, the believers, men and women... Allah has prepared for them forgiveness and a great reward.  (Al-Ahzab 33: 35)

    Allah mentions them entering into Paradise together, saying:

    They and their wives will be in pleasant shade.  (Ya Sin 36: 56)

    Enter Paradise, you and your wives, in happiness.  (Az-Zukhruf 43: 70)

    Allah also mentions that He will recreate women in Paradise in the following verse:

     Lo! We have created them a (new) creation. And made them virgins…  (Al-Waqi`ah 56: 35-36) That is, Allah will recreate the elderly women and make them virgins; the same will be done for old men, Allah will make them youth.

    It is also mentioned in the Hadith that the women of this worldly life have a superiority over Al-hur Al-`In due to the acts of worship and obedience that they performed in this world. Therefore, the believing women will enter Paradise just like the believing men. If a woman had a number of husbands, she, upon entering Paradise with them, would choose among them the one with the best character and behavior.
    Excerpted, with slight modifications, from: http://www.uh.edu/campus/msa/article....html#paradise

    Thus, rest assured dear sister that Allah never wrongs anyone, male or female, nor does He, Almighty, deprive any person of his/her work’s fruit.

    As-salamu `alaykum. Some traditional Muslims believe that Muslim men will be rewarded with 70 houris specially created for them and two believing women from this life. This is very demeaning and offensive to all women.

    A question comes to my mind at this point. Why would God cause jealousy between husband and wife on this earth when He promises to give the same cause of jealousy (multiple wives) in Heaven to one gender (man) as a reward? Who put love, mercy, and affection between the spouses? It is sad to find that in traditional Muslim literature the concept of Heaven is a place specially created for men; there is no equality between men and women.

    For men, Heaven is simply an extension of the earth where they established control and dominance over women through legitimizing unsanctioned polygamy and unlimited sex with females. One man’s Heaven is a woman’s Hell. This is supported by scholars, as a majority of them state that Paradise is a place of fulfillment of desires, and men—being prone to polygamy—will receive this as a reward.

    My question is, how is it possible that Allah Almighty will grant the fulfillment of the desires of the male but not of the female—that is, to not share her husband with multiple women?

    What about women who are patient in this life, hoping that their desire of not sharing their husbands will come true? I have read that scholars state that Allah will remove the “jealousy” from the heart of the women so they shouldn’t worry about it. Please explain how does this justify anything?

    Instead of her desire/wish being fulfilled, she will be brainwashed, but on the other hand men won’t have to give up anything. Why won’t Allah remove the lust to have multiple wives from their hearts in order to please the female servants, while He will remove jealousy from the hearts of females in order to please male servants?

    How come jealousy is a “female” product? When men are jealous, their jealousy is labeled as “ghayrah” (attack on morality). Bur when women are “jealous”, they are labeled as jealous beings? How I see it, being neutral, jealousy is a human product and not just a female thing. Allah created one mate, at least that’s what is mentioned in the Qur’an, for Adam (peace be upon him).

    Therefore it is the fitrah of every male and female to feel “jealousy” when it is about sharing one’s spouse. Men are more possessive and would react in a similar way, even worse when it is about sharing their spouse. The reason is because we are both human beings. I totally agree with the “acceptance” of polygamy in this life, because it is a “solution” advised in the situations to avoid the haram. But it is discouraged by putting conditions on it. But paradise is every Muslim’s (men and women) goal. It doesn’t sound/feel right to the fitrah that it will be more rewarding towards men and again will require females to sacrifice and share. No matter how you put it, it is sharing the reward when one’s husband will have at least two other wives.

    Does Allah love men more than women? A male martyr will receive 70 wives, but if a female servant of Allah dies for Jihad fisabillillah, she will still be required to share her husband with other wives. This concept is very discouraging and offensive towards Muslim sisters.

    I personally feel like crying because it seems that no matter how hard I work to please Allah, even go as far as giving up my life for Allah Almighty, my reward will not be equivalent to that of a male servant.




    Wa `alaykum as-salamu wa rahmatullahi wa barakatuh.
    In the Name of Allah, Most Gracious, Most Merciful.

    All praise and thanks are due to Allah, and peace and blessings be upon His Messenger.

    Sister, first of all, we’d like to say that we are impressed by your question, which emanates from a thoughtful heart. May Allah Almighty help us all adhere to the principles of this true religion, Islam, and enable us to be among the dwellers of Paradise in the Hereafter.

    Paradise is the abode of the believers in the Hereafter. Allah has prepared for His believing servants, males and females, in Paradise indescribable bliss which no eye has seen, no ear has heard of, and that has never ever crossed the minds of people, to the extent that even the person who has the least blessings in Paradise will think that he is the most blessed one.

    In more than one Qur’anic verse, Allah Most High, calls upon His servants to do their utmost in order to be favored with Paradise. For example, He says, And vie one with another for forgiveness from your Lord, and for a Paradise as wide as are the heavens and the earth, prepared for those who ward off (evil). (Aal `Imran 3: 133)

    As regards your question, we’d like to inform you that in Paradise believing men and women will be showered with blessings; there is no room for discrimination based on sex in Paradise. The life of women in jannah will be as pleasant and happy as the life of men. Allah is not partial to any sex. He created both of them and He will take care of both of them according to their needs and desires. Let us all work to achieve the jannah and then, in sha’ Allah, we will find there what will satisfy all of us fully.

    In his response to your question, Dr. Sano Koutoub Moustapha, professor of Fiqh and its Principles, International Islamic University, Malaysia, states the following:


    Thank you so much for your very interesting comments and understanding of the issue of polygamy and the blessings given to men in Heaven.

    I congratulate you for your logical ability and critical way of looking at things. However, I shall also confirm to you the issue of polygamy, be it in this life or the hereafter, it should not be classified as a privilege but rather a solution as you correctly mentioned in your arguments.

    In other words, Islam does not open the door of polygamy for all men as it does not open it to women at all. As you may know well that each ruling or law has an exception and the exception is not the principle, therefore, we can not judge a law through its exceptions.

    In this regard, I shall remind you that rewarding a mujahid with many wives doesn’t mean betraying the female mujahid.

    It simply means there is a such reward for those mujahids who are looking for it. In other words, there is no compulsion upon all mujahids to accept or reject this reward. It is exactly the same thing as the polygamy in this life.

    It is meant for those who want it, not for every single mujahid. Yet every Muslim man and woman who is allowed to enter Heaven is given the opportunity to get whatever he or she wants as clearly stated in the Qur’an and many Hadiths of the Prophet (peace and blessings be upon him). This means that those women who don’t want their husbands to have more could be granted this wish and desire. At the same time if the husbands of those women want to have more than them Allah is great and can satisfy each of them in the way He, the Almighty, wants.

    Therefore, a woman should not be frustrated for a privilege of polygamy offered to men. This is not, for sure, at the expense of woman. Heaven is meant for both men and women, both of them are equally entitled to get what they wish for.

    Certainly, there would be no clashes in their wishes, if any, the Almighty knows how to please each of them. Having said that, I shall inform you that the existing setup of humans in terms of desire, would be changed on the Day of Judgment.

    In other words, both men and women would not be allowed to enter Heaven in their existing physical makeup. They will be in a better and greater form as stated by the Prophet (peace and blessings be upon him). Both of them would enjoy living together and having whatever they wish and like.

    Finally, the Prophet (peace and blessings be upon him) describes Heaven as a place where there are many things which no eyes have ever seen, no ears have ever heard before and no heart has ever felt. Let us pray the Almighty to grant us this great and wonderful place. Let us work harder and harder to be in this place. It is only through our full submission to the will and the orders of Allah that we will one day be granted this place.
